> 
> Now, the taginfo file only gets 10 command line arguments, $0 thru $9.  The
> first file tagged would be $4 and its rev $5.  This means that I only get
> the first 3 files and their rev. numbers.
> 
> I need all file names and rev. numbers.  Is there a way?
> 

I have modified the log.pl script (I think a common script used by
CVS users, and referenced by the book of Karl Vogel) to change it in a
lotag.pl.

So, with this script, I get all the files and their revision numbers, to 
generate a log message like this one:

And so getting with perl more than 10 arguments from the command line.
If someone want my script, I will be pleased to send it (as I don't think that
attachement to a list is good feature).

This script now send to a log file and to as many mail address you want, this
log message when a tag is done. Actually, the script generate one log message
per sub-directory of your tagge module. The next step I would include in this
script, is that it send only one mail per module (grouping all directories
and their files).
